Output dda269379700eba3868e534136d8708c2e638e7e57c9ffa5ae9df5513be4b1ff:11

value
169141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b699002ae5ccea6ba7d88f99640c5ba14dc536d3 OP_EQUAL
address
3JLWC8RKvASTJtRLLfyjANQusudqf6jjqa
transaction
dda269379700eba3868e534136d8708c2e638e7e57c9ffa5ae9df5513be4b1ff
confirmations
64986
spent
true